Naviga is an executive search firm for sales, marketing, finance, and operations. We operate as a true extension of your team, customizing every partnership to fit your unique needs and providing deep talent acquisition expertise, industry insight, and white-glove service.
Our proprietary search process, refined over 2 decades, ensures precision and delivers results. Each candidate undergoes a thorough internal evaluation before presentation, driving a success rate of 1 hire per 4 candidates presented and a 95% retention rate year after year.

The Informed Candidate Approach
At Naviga, we believe that an informed candidate is an empowered one. Our unique approach goes far beyond a standard job description, providing you with a transparent and comprehensive view of every opportunity.
We equip you with in-depth details on the client’s business opportunity, the strategic goals of the position, and the vision of the hiring managers. This ensures you have a complete understanding of the role, allowing you to confidently and deliberately pursue the right career move.
